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Kidderminster to Heysham is to bus which costs £18 - £35 and takes 7h 43m.
The fastest way to get from Kidderminster to Heysham is to drive which takes 2h 36m and costs £30 - £50.
No, there is no direct bus from Kidderminster to Heysham. However, there are services departing from Town Hall and arriving at Dalesview Crescent via Halesowen Bus Station, Newhall St and Underpass.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 43m.
The distance between Kidderminster and Heysham is 153 miles. The road distance is 138.7 miles.
The best way to get from Kidderminster to Heysham without a car is to train and bus which takes 5h 3m and costs £45 - £100.
It takes approximately 5h 3m to get from Kidderminster to Heysham, including transfers.
Kidderminster to Heysham b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Newhall St station.
Kidderminster to Heysham b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Underpass station.
Yes, the driving distance between Kidderminster to Heysham is 139 miles. It takes approximately 2h 36m to drive from Kidderminster to Heysham.
